Groundskeeper crushed by 10,000 pounds of dirt in Greenwich

Officials are investigating the cause of a trench collapse at a Greenwich golf course that killed one worker.Jose Medina was working on a trench when it collapsed, crushing him with 10,000 pounds of dirt. When emergency services arrived at the seventh hole of the golf course at Tamarack Country Club, Medina had been pulled from the trench unconscious. Medina later died from his injuries.Medina, 59, had been a groundskeeper at the club for almost 31 years. His co-workers remember him as a great worker and an even better person. Medina, of White Plains, leaves behind two children and two grandchildren.
